在Java中,關(guān)于鎖我想大家都很熟悉阱飘。在并發(fā)編程中摘昌,我們通過鎖速妖,來避免由于競爭而造成的數(shù)據(jù)不一致問題。通常聪黎,我們以synchronized 罕容、Lock來使用它。 但是Java...
在Java中,關(guān)于鎖我想大家都很熟悉阱飘。在并發(fā)編程中摘昌,我們通過鎖速妖,來避免由于競爭而造成的數(shù)據(jù)不一致問題。通常聪黎,我們以synchronized 罕容、Lock來使用它。 但是Java...
在網(wǎng)上上我看已經(jīng)有好多關(guān)于Elasticsearch的介紹稿饰,我就不在翻來覆去講一些基本概念锦秒,大家感興趣的可以自己去找一些資料鞏固下。我這只為了顧及眾多首次接觸Elastics...
什么是synchronized喉镰? synchronized是java提供的一個關(guān)鍵字旅择。可以用來修飾一個方法侣姆,一段代碼塊,來達(dá)到一個鎖的作用生真。 synchronized有什么用...
第一次理解: 剛學(xué)java時,對于volatile的記憶就是: volatile保證可見性 volatile防止指令重排序 volatile不保證原子性 沒過腦的背了一下铺敌,寫...
前幾天路過一個經(jīng)常負(fù)責(zé)面試的同事附近汇歹,看到幾個人在討論volatile的可見性問題,當(dāng)時第一感覺是 :“可見性還不簡單嗎偿凭?volatile修飾一個變量時产弹,那么在一個線程都對這...
來源:https://www.cnblogs.com/biglittleant/p/8979915.html作者:biglittleant 限流算法 令牌桶算法 算法思想是:...
來自:掘金悬垃,作者:堅持就是勝利鏈接:https://juejin.im/post/5dccf260f265da0bf66b626d “ 今天游昼,我不自量力的面試了某大廠的 Ja...
我覺得現(xiàn)在嫂子比我技術(shù)好了
如何實(shí)現(xiàn)一個簡單的RPC在如何給老婆解釋什么是RPC中标锄,我們討論了RPC的實(shí)現(xiàn)思路顽铸。那么這一次,就讓我們通過代碼來實(shí)現(xiàn)一個簡單的RPC吧鸯绿! RPC的實(shí)現(xiàn)原理 正如上一講所說跋破,RPC主要是為了解決的兩...
前言 Redis緩存淘汰策略與Redis鍵的過期刪除策略并不完全相同,前者是在Redis內(nèi)存使用超過一定值的時候(一般這個值可以配置)使用的淘汰策略租幕;而后者是通過定期刪除+惰...
1.配置多數(shù)據(jù)源 配置application.yml 其中 master 數(shù)據(jù)源一定是要配置 作為我們的默認(rèn)數(shù)據(jù)源舷手,其次cluster集群中,其他的數(shù)據(jù)不配置也不會影響程序員...
其實(shí)很多程序員都會利用休息時間接私活男窟,這樣每年大概會拿到十萬左右的額外收入。接私活的方式有很多種贾富,接私活的過程其實(shí)也是在累積人脈的過程歉眷,累積私活的過程,就像不知道哪天客戶還會...
1. 前言 斷斷續(xù)續(xù)寫了一段時間的設(shè)計模式颤枪,終于把經(jīng)典的23種設(shè)計模式全寫完了汗捡。下面對這些設(shè)計模式總結(jié)一下。 2. 設(shè)計原則 設(shè)計原則的介紹 : [設(shè)計模式的六大原則]即使我...